At The Rising Sun, travellers highlight a scenic riverside setting, spacious rooms with appealing views, and consistently friendly, accommodating staff that make stays feel relaxed and welcoming for both short breaks and longer visits.
Read moreWas this helpful?
At The Rising Sun, travellers highlight a scenic riverside setting, spacious rooms with appealing views, and consistently friendly, accommodating staff that make stays feel relaxed and welcoming for both short breaks and longer visits.
Food is a strong point, with many praising generous, tasty meals and standout breakfasts. Balancing this, some guests mention rooms that feel cold or less comfortable, occasional maintenance and cleanliness touch-ups, sporadic service issues, and parking that can be difficult at busy times. Expect a characterful riverside pub stay with generally comfortable rooms and hearty dining.
